Duties will include (but are not limited to):

  • Acting as the key point of contact for HR queries providing guidance on HR policies, processes and operating procedures to employees and managers

  • Supporting the full recruitment life cycle for appointing academic and non-academic staff which will include; advertising vacancies, maintaining the school website, track applications, prepare shortlisting packs and liaise with candidates and hiring managers for interviews

  • Assisting the HR Advisor with the onboarding process for successful candidates ensuring all pre-employment checks have been carried out including, eligibility to work, DBS and health checks, ensuring supporting documentation has been checked, and systems and files have been updated accordingly

  • Creating and maintaining employee records, physically and in relevant databases (iSAMS and SuccessFactors)

  • Under the guidance of the HR Advisor, ensure that the Single Central Record is kept up to date and is compliant with Keeping Children Safe in Education guidance

  • Ensuring the completion of leaver paperwork, arrange exit interviews and archive files as necessary

  • Keeping up to date with changes in employment law and best practice and inform as necessary
